How Client-Centred Work Fits into Online Therapy

Client-Centred Therapy focuses on the person rather than on labels. The counsellor listens closely, reflects back what they hear and follows the client’s pace. This approach helps people who are anxious, stressed or dealing with relationship and family difficulties to feel understood and to explore solutions that make sense to them.

The therapist’s role is to offer empathy, acceptance and clear feedback rather than to direct every step. In practice this means sessions focus on what the client wants to work on and adapt as goals change. Ornella will work together with each person to choose which methods and conversation styles suit their needs and preferences.

Online formats include video calls, phone sessions, live chat and text-based messaging. Video calls allow face-to-face conversation and visual cues. Phone sessions are useful when bandwidth is limited or a quieter audio check-in is preferred. Live chat and text messaging can be shorter, more frequent touchpoints for brief updates or when typing feels easier. These options help people fit counselling around work, family and travel, offering more flexibility and easier access to regular support.
